Original Buff® is based outside of Barcelona, Spain, and opened a U.S. sales office in early 2003. Popular for more than a decade in Europe and used since the show’s inception on CBS’s Survivor television series, Buff® Headwear is distributed in more than 42 countries. Buff® performance headwear is all about versatilities and simplicity – one garment serves many functions. Among other uses, a Buff® can be worn as a hat, neck gaiter, balaclava, bandana, scarf, hairband, helmet liner, headband, pirate-style cap or a sun, wind or dust screen. Designed to offer technical performance and protection from the elements during a wide range of outdoor activities and sports, Buff® Headwear is available in hundreds of styles and designs. Buff® Headwear Ready to Make a Strong Comeback at Interbike 2008
SANTA ROSA, Calif. (September 22, 2008)- Buff® Headwear, innovator of the popular, versatile and multifunctional headwear, returns to Interbike in 2008 after a four year hiatus. By doing so, the company plans to expand its highly relevant product offerings to a collection of independent bicycle dealers (IBDs) with more leading-edge technology and cyclist-friendly designs.
“Over the past four years Buff® has grown significantly to enable a smooth return to Interbike in 2008 and we are beyond excited to participate once again,” said Shirley Choi Brunetti, general manager, United States.

Buff Incorporates Polygiene for Active Odor Control
SANTA ROSA, Calif. (September 22, 2008)- Buff Headwear, trendsetter of popular, versatile and multifunctional headwear, continues down the path of leading-edge innovation by upgrading the various Buff product offerings with Polygiene technology. Starting in January of 2009, all Buff headwear garments will include Polygiene technology to fight against odor-causing bacteria and maintain Buff’s freshness.
